ActivationSigmoid |
f(x) = 1 / (1 + exp(-x))
|
ActivationSoftmax |
f_i(x) = exp(x_i - shift) / sum_j exp(x_j - shift)
where shift = max_i(x_i)
|
ActivationSoftPlus |
f(x) = log(1+e^x)
|
ActivationSoftSign |
f_i(x) = x_i / (1+|x_i|)
|
ActivationSwish |
f(x) = x * sigmoid(x)
|
ActivationTanH |
f(x) = (exp(x) - exp(-x)) / (exp(x) + exp(-x))
